NCT00030589
RATIONALE: Drugs used in chemotherapy use different ways to stop cancer cells from dividing so they stop growing or die. Photodynamic therapy uses light and drugs that make cancer cells more sensitive to light to kill cancer cells. Photosensitizing drugs, such as methoxsalen, are absorbed by cancer cells and, when exposed to light, become active and kill the cancer cells. Combining chemotherapy with photodynamic therapy may be an effective treatment for cutaneous T-cell lymphoma. PURPOSE: Randomized phase II trial to study the effectiveness of combining different doses of bexarotene with photodynamic therapy in treating patients who have stage IB or stage IIA cutaneous T-cell lymphoma.

NCT01871948
Cancer patients often experience problems in their care, many of which are caused by communication breakdowns. Some communication breakdowns lead to adverse events and even harmful errors. Deficiencies in provider-patient communication can compound patients' distress, lower the quality of care, and disrupt patient-provider relationships. There is little research on patients' and providers' experiences of the communication breakdowns that precipitate adverse events and errors, or on effective responses to these events. Because of this, cancer providers are unsure how to communicate with patients in these difficult situations. The goal of the proposed study is to improve patient-centered communication around adverse events and errors in cancer care. Our specific aims are: 1) To describe patients' experiences with communication around adverse events and errors in cancer care, 2) To describe providers' experiences and practices with communication around adverse events and errors in cancer care, 3) To develop practical recommendations, provider training materials and patient educational materials for improving communication around adverse events and errors in cancer care, 4) To disseminate the recommendations and materials through three health plans, and 5) To conduct a preliminary evaluation of the perceived usefulness and impact of the materials. The investigators will first conduct interviews with breast and colorectal cancer patients who have experienced adverse events or errors at 3 Cancer Research Network (CRN) health plans (Atlanta, Georgia; Seattle, Washington and Worcester, Massachusetts). The interviews will focus on instances where patients believe that better communication might have prevented an adverse event or error, or mitigated the event's impact. Next the investigators will conduct focus groups to understand providers' attitudes and experiences with these communication dilemmas, and use simulations to describe providers' communication practices. Finally, the investigators will interview health plan leaders to identify the systems factors that influence communication with patients around adverse events and errors. These perspectives will be synthesized to create patient and provider educational material for improving communication. Three advisory panels: a Patient Advisory Panel, a Health Plan Advisory Panel and a Dissemination Advisory Panel (including all 14 CRN health plans) will help create and disseminate these educational interventions. Dissemination will occur at the three core clinical sites. The investigators use patient and provider surveys to evaluate the educational materials' impact. This evaluation will provide the evidence-base to refine the study products before widespread dissemination throughout the CRN and beyond.
